Référence du schéma de fichier de projet MSBuild

 

Pour obtenir la dernière documentation sur Visual Studio 2017, consultez Documentation Visual Studio 2017.

Fournit un tableau de tous les MSBuild des éléments de schéma XML avec leurs éléments enfants et attributs disponibles.

MSBuild utilise des fichiers projet pour indiquer que le moteur de génération de création et de la procédure de création. MSBuild les fichiers projet sont des fichiers XML qui respectent le MSBuild schéma XML. Cette section documente le fichier XML schema definition (.xsd) pour MSBuild.

Le tableau suivant répertorie tous les MSBuild des éléments de schéma XML, ainsi que leurs éléments enfants et d’attributs.

ÉlémentÉléments enfantsAttributs
Choose, élément (MSBuild)Dans le cas contraire

Lorsque
--
Import, élément (MSBuild)--Condition

Projet
Élément ImportGroupImportCondition
Item, élément (MSBuild)ItemMetaDataCondition

Exclure

Inclure

Remove
ItemDefinitionGroup, élément (MSBuild)ÉlémentCondition
ItemGroup, élément (MSBuild)ÉlémentCondition
ItemMetadata, élément (MSBuild)ÉlémentCondition
OnError, élément (MSBuild)--Condition

ExecuteTargets
Otherwise, élément (MSBuild)Choisir

ItemGroup

PropertyGroup
--
Output, élément (MSBuild)--Condition

ItemName

PropertyName

TaskParameter
Parameter, élément--Sortie

ParameterType

Obligatoire
Élément ParameterGroupParamètre--
Project, élément (MSBuild)Choisir

Import

ItemGroup

ProjectExtensions

PropertyGroup

une cible

UsingTask
DefaultTargets

InitialTargets

ToolsVersion

TreatAsLocalProperty

xmlns
ProjectExtensions, élément (MSBuild)----
Property, élément (MSBuild)--Condition
PropertyGroup, élément (MSBuild)PropriétéCondition
Target, élément (MSBuild)OnError

 Tâche
AfterTargets

BeforeTargets

Condition

DependsOnTargets

Inputs (Entrées)

KeepDuplicateOutputs

Nom

Sorties

Returns (Retours)
Task, élément (MSBuild)SortieCondition

ContinueOnError

 Paramètre
Élément TaskBody (MSBuild)DonnéesÉvaluer
UsingTask, élément (MSBuild)ParameterGroup

TaskBody
AssemblyFile

AssemblyName

Condition

TaskFactory

Nom de la tâche
Lorsque, élément (MSBuild)Choisir

ItemGroup

PropertyGroup
Condition

Référence des tâches
Conditions
Référence MSBuild
MSBuild

Afficher: